This recipe is for 2 people
Time required : 2h30min
Baking time : 35-40min
Resting time : 3h
Rice :
100g round rice
250g whole milk
1/2 vanilla pod
20g sugar
50g liquid cream (30% fat)
Caramel :
80g sugar
80g liquid cream (30% fat)
30g salted butter
Caramelized rice :
20g puffed rice
20g sugar
5g butter
DIRECTIONS
Prepare the Rice:
Blanch the rice: bring it to a boil in water, then drain using a fine sieve or strainer.
Cook the Rice:
In a saucepan, combine the rice with milk, vanilla, and sugar.
Simmer gently over low heat for about 10 -15 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the rice is tender and creamy.
Transfer the cooked rice to a bowl and let it cool in the fridge for at least 4 hours.
Make the Whipped Cream:
Whip the heavy cream until it’s firm yet airy, maintaining a mousse-like texture.
Gently fold the whipped cream into the rice to create a creamy and light riz au lait.
Prepare the Caramel Sauce:
In a dry pan, make a dry caramel (at medium heat) by heating sugar until it melts and reaches a deep amber color.
Carefully add the butter, stirring until fully incorporated.
Slowly drizzle in the heavy cream while stirring continuously with a spatula to avoid splattering.
Optional Garnish for Texture:
Caramelize puffed rice (and optionally some nuts) in a caramel to add a crunchy topping.
Assembly:
Ensure all elements are cold before plating for better consistency.
To serve, you create a small well in the riz au lait and pour in some caramel sauce.
Garnish with the caramelized puffed rice and nuts if desired.
